Panel: The Global Academic Perspective: How to Gear up to Upskilling 650M People Digitally by 2030. Are we on Track?

- Goal: Discuss strategies to achieve the ambitious target of digitally upskilling 650 million people by 2030.
- Key Topics: Actionable plans, innovative approaches, and collaborative efforts for large-scale digital education and skill development.
- Insights: Creating effective upskilling initiatives, leveraging technology, and fostering partnerships.
- Objective: Provide attendees with practical guidance to meet this critical global objective.
